According to the La Republica newspaper, edited in Colombia, the cigars from the Dominican Republic have reached an extraordinary place in the international arena.
In an extensive report, the newspaper highlights that with approximately 220 million cigars produced each year, the Dominican Republic is the main exporter in the world, above countries such as Nicaragua, Cuba and Honduras, with exports each year of 170 million, 90 million and 70 million, respectively.
The report states that the fame of Dominican cigars is well established, given that the producers, especially in the Cibao Valley, have been working with the tobacco leaves for more than a century.
